About this course

Molecular biology is one of the great intellectual achievements of twentieth century science. Beginning with the discovery of the structure of DNA in the 1950s and culminating in the sequencing of the human genome, molecular biology has transformed our understanding of how living organisms work, how genes are expressed and regulated, and how mutations underlie disease. Today it underpins entire industries in biotechnology and pharmaceuticals, and it continues to advance rapidly, with genome engineering technologies now enabling precise editing of DNA in ways that will have profound impacts on medicine, agriculture, and our understanding of life itself. At the University of Aberdeen, this four-year full-time programme includes a year abroad, giving you international research experience alongside the core academic content. The programme moves from foundational molecular and cellular biology in the early years to cutting-edge content in later years, covering gene expression, protein structure and function, cell signalling, genome engineering, and the molecular basis of disease. Aberdeen has a strong research profile in biomedical and molecular sciences, and the programme reflects the research activity of a faculty who are actively advancing knowledge in the field. The year abroad adds an international dimension, allowing you to encounter different research environments and to build scientific networks that may be valuable throughout your career. You will develop laboratory skills in molecular techniques that are standard in research and industry, alongside the ability to design experiments, analyse data, and engage critically with scientific literature. Graduates from molecular biology programmes pursue careers in pharmaceutical research, biotechnology, medical research, genomics, clinical research, science writing, and regulatory science. Many continue to postgraduate study, including PhD programmes in molecular biology, biochemistry, cell biology, or related disciplines, which is the standard route into academic and industrial research careers.
